  • 2. 

    CMYK color mode stands for

    • A.

      Red, Marine, Orange, White

    • B.

      Cyan, Maroon, Yellow, Blue

    • C.

      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black

    • D.

      Codec, Max, Light, Dark

    • E.

      Red, Green, Blue, White

    Correct Answer
    C.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black
    Explanation
    CMYK color mode stands for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black. In this color mode, colors are created by combining these four primary colors in varying amounts. Cyan represents the blue-green color, Magenta represents a purplish-red color, Yellow represents a bright yellow color, and Black represents the absence of color or darkness. This color mode is commonly used in printing and is used to create a wide range of colors by combining these four primary colors in different proportions.

  • 4. 

    With clone stamp tool selected, to select the source pixels you will press

    • A.

      Ctrl

    • B.

      Shift+Ctrl

    • C.

      Enter

    • D.

      Alt

    • E.

      Alt+Enter

    Correct Answer
    D. Alt
    Explanation
    To select the source pixels using the clone stamp tool, you will press the Alt key. This key allows you to sample an area of the image that you want to clone or copy from. By holding down the Alt key and clicking on the desired source pixels, you can then use the clone stamp tool to paint or clone those pixels onto another area of the image.

  • 5. 

    From tools palette the selection tool that selects on the basis of similar color is

    • A.

      Clone stamp tool

    • B.

      Magic wand tool

    • C.

      History Brush tool

    • D.

      Smudge tool

    • E.

      Marquee tool

    Correct Answer
    B. Magic wand tool
    Explanation
    The Magic Wand tool is the selection tool from the tools palette that selects based on similar color. This tool allows users to select areas of an image that have similar colors or tones. It works by selecting pixels that are within a specified range of color or tone values. This tool is particularly useful when trying to select areas with a consistent color or tone, such as selecting a blue sky or a green grassy area in a landscape photo.
